← Back to index
|
Original Bugzilla link
Bug 18993 – toLower is broken for UTF chars
Status
RESOLVED
Resolution
FIXED
Severity
regression
Priority
P1
Component
phobos
Product
D
Version
D2
Platform
All
OS
All
Creation time
2018-06-15T12:15:36Z
Last change time
2020-03-21T03:56:36Z
Keywords
pull
Assigned to
No Owner
Creator
Temtaime
Comments
Comment #0
by temtaime — 2018-06-15T12:15:36Z
static assert(`몬스터/A`.toLower.length == `몬스터/a`.toLower.length);
Comment #1
by temtaime — 2018-06-15T12:18:38Z
It converts UTF chars into something totally wrong so they break down
Comment #2
by b2.temp — 2018-06-15T13:40:16Z
caused by
https://github.com/dlang/phobos/pull/6545/files
Comment #3
by b2.temp — 2018-06-17T08:10:10Z
Pull
https://github.com/dlang/phobos/pull/6586
Comment #4
by github-bugzilla — 2018-06-24T13:28:22Z
Commits pushed to master at
https://github.com/dlang/phobos
https://github.com/dlang/phobos/commit/7dc672f5bbf78d52b0142976d0928e8542460ba7
fix issue 18993 - toLower is broken for UTF chars
https://github.com/dlang/phobos/commit/238fb7665cbef67401f303032e3f717b48f3dbe8
Merge pull request #6586 from BBasile/issue-18993 fix issue 18993 (REG ~master) - toLower is broken for UTF chars